excel怎么把尾数变成想要的数字

excel怎么把尾数变成想要的数字

在Excel中,将尾数变成你想要的数字的方法有多种,包括使用函数、公式和格式化工具等。 具体方法有:使用ROUND函数、使用文本函数、使用VBA代码。下面将详细介绍其中一种方法——使用ROUND函数。

使用ROUND函数可以有效地将数字的尾数四舍五入到你想要的数位。比如,你可以使用ROUND函数将小数部分四舍五入到最近的整数、十位、百位等。具体操作方法如下:

  1. 在Excel单元格中输入公式:=ROUND(数字, 位数)
  2. 其中,"数字"是你要处理的数字,"位数"是你想保留的小数位数。如果位数为0,则表示四舍五入到最近的整数。

例如:

  • =ROUND(123.456, 0) 会将结果变为123。
  • =ROUND(123.456, 2) 会将结果变为123.46。

一、使用ROUND函数

ROUND函数在Excel中是非常常用的,它能帮助你将数字的尾数四舍五入到指定的数位。这对于需要精确控制数据呈现的场景非常有用。

1. ROUND函数的基本用法

ROUND函数的基本语法为 =ROUND(number, num_digits)。其中,“number”是你要进行四舍五入的数字,“num_digits”是指定要保留的小数位数。例如,如果你想将数字123.456四舍五入到整数,可以使用公式 =ROUND(123.456, 0),结果为123;如果你想保留两位小数,可以使用公式 =ROUND(123.456, 2),结果为123.46。

2. 应用场景

财务报表:在财务报表中,通常需要将数据精确到小数点后两位。这时可以使用 =ROUND(数字, 2),确保数据统一且易于理解。

统计分析:在统计分析中,有时需要将数据四舍五入到整数,便于后续的计算和比较。这时可以使用 =ROUND(数字, 0)

数据呈现:在Excel图表中,如果数据小数位数太多,会显得图表杂乱无章。使用ROUND函数可以简化数据,提高图表的可读性。

二、使用TEXT函数

TEXT函数可以将数字格式化为文本,并且可以指定显示的格式。这对于需要将数字尾数变成特定格式的情况非常有用。

1. TEXT函数的基本用法

TEXT函数的基本语法为 =TEXT(value, format_text)。其中,“value”是你要格式化的数字,“format_text”是指定的格式。例如,如果你想将数字123.456格式化为“123.46”,可以使用公式 =TEXT(123.456, "0.00")

2. 应用场景

自定义格式:在某些情况下,你可能需要将数字格式化为特定的格式,例如货币、百分比等。使用TEXT函数可以轻松实现这一点。例如, =TEXT(1234.56, "$#,##0.00") 会将结果显示为“$1,234.56”。

拼接文本和数字:有时候,你可能需要将文本和数字拼接在一起并显示在单元格中。使用TEXT函数可以确保数字格式符合你的要求。例如, ="销售额: " & TEXT(1234.56, "$#,##0.00") 会将结果显示为“销售额: $1,234.56”。

三、使用VBA代码

如果你需要进行更复杂的尾数处理,使用VBA代码是一个强大的工具。通过编写VBA宏,你可以实现几乎所有你能想到的数字处理功能。

1. VBA代码示例

下面是一个简单的VBA代码示例,展示如何将尾数变成你想要的数字:

Sub ChangeTailNumber()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ng

If IsNumeric(cell.Value) Then

cell.Value = Round(cell.Value, 0) ' 将尾数四舍五入到整数

End If

Next cell

End Sub

2. 应用场景

批量处理:当你需要对大量数据进行尾数处理时,手动操作会非常繁琐。这时可以使用VBA宏批量处理数据,提高工作效率。

复杂逻辑:有时候,你需要根据特定的逻辑来处理数字的尾数。使用VBA代码可以实现复杂的逻辑判断和处理,例如根据不同的条件进行不同的尾数处理。

四、使用条件格式化

条件格式化是Excel中一个强大的工具,可以根据单元格的值自动应用特定的格式。这对于需要动态显示特定格式的数字非常有用。

1. 条件格式化的基本用法

你可以使用条件格式化来根据数字的值动态应用特定的格式。例如,如果你想将大于1000的数字尾数变为“千”单位,可以使用条件格式化设置:

  1. 选择需要应用条件格式的单元格范围。
  2. 点击“开始”菜单中的“条件格式”,选择“新建规则”。
  3. 选择“使用公式确定要设置格式的单元格”,输入公式 =A1>1000
  4. 点击“格式”,在“自定义”中输入 #,"千"

2. 应用场景

动态展示:在某些场景中,你可能需要根据数据的变化动态调整数字的格式。使用条件格式化可以实现这一点,确保数据展示的灵活性。

数据警示:条件格式化还可以用于数据警示,例如当某个数字超出预期范围时,自动高亮显示。这对于数据监控和分析非常有用。

五、使用自定义格式

Excel提供了丰富的自定义格式选项,可以根据你的需要将数字格式化为特定的样式。这对于需要将尾数变成特定格式的情况非常有用。

1. 自定义格式的基本用法

你可以在单元格中应用自定义格式,将数字格式化为特定的样式。例如,如果你想将数字1234.56显示为“1234.6”,可以使用以下步骤:

  1. 选择需要应用自定义格式的单元格范围。
  2. 右键点击选择“设置单元格格式”。
  3. 在“数字”选项卡中选择“自定义”。
  4. 输入格式代码 0.0

2. 应用场景

简化数据展示:有时候,数据的小数位数太多会影响可读性。使用自定义格式可以简化数据展示,提高可读性。

特定格式要求:在某些场景中,你可能需要将数字格式化为特定的样式,例如百分比、货币等。使用自定义格式可以满足这些需求。

六、使用替换功能

Excel的替换功能也可以用于将尾数变成你想要的数字。虽然这种方法不如前面的几种方法灵活,但在某些特定场景下非常有用。

1. 替换功能的基本用法

你可以使用替换功能将特定的数字尾数替换为你想要的数字。例如,如果你想将所有以“.56”结尾的数字替换为“.60”,可以使用以下步骤:

  1. 选择需要进行替换的单元格范围。
  2. 点击“开始”菜单中的“查找和选择”,选择“替换”。
  3. 在“查找内容”中输入“.56”,在“替换为”中输入“.60”。
  4. 点击“全部替换”。

2. 应用场景

快速修正数据:当你需要快速修正大量数据中的特定尾数时,替换功能非常有用。例如,在数据清洗过程中,你可能需要将所有的错误数据修正为正确的格式。

简单的数据处理:对于一些简单的数据处理任务,替换功能可以快速完成,而无需编写复杂的公式或代码。

七、使用数组公式

数组公式是Excel中的高级功能,可以用于处理复杂的数据操作。通过使用数组公式,你可以实现一些常规公式无法完成的任务。

1. 数组公式的基本用法

数组公式的基本语法与普通公式相似,只是需要在输入公式后按下 Ctrl+Shift+Enter 键来应用。例如,如果你想将一列数字的尾数四舍五入到整数,可以使用以下步骤:

  1. 选择需要应用数组公式的单元格范围。
  2. 输入公式 =ROUND(A1:A10, 0)
  3. 按下 Ctrl+Shift+Enter 键。

2. 应用场景

批量数据处理:当你需要对一列或多列数据进行相同的尾数处理时,数组公式非常有用。例如,你可以使用数组公式将整个数据范围内的数字尾数四舍五入到整数。

复杂数据计算:数组公式可以用于处理复杂的数据计算任务,例如根据特定条件进行数据筛选和处理。这对于高级数据分析非常有用。

八、使用Power Query

Power Query是Excel中的一个强大工具,可以用于数据导入、清洗和转换。通过使用Power Query,你可以轻松实现复杂的数据处理任务,包括将尾数变成你想要的数字。

1. Power Query的基本用法

你可以使用Power Query将数据导入到Excel,并进行数据清洗和转换。例如,如果你想将一列数字的尾数四舍五入到整数,可以使用以下步骤:

  1. 在Excel中点击“数据”菜单,选择“从表/范围”。
  2. 在Power Query编辑器中,选择需要处理的列。
  3. 在“转换”菜单中,选择“四舍五入”。
  4. 将数据加载回Excel。

2. 应用场景

数据清洗:Power Query非常适合用于数据清洗任务,例如将数据中的错误值修正为正确的格式。通过使用Power Query,你可以轻松实现复杂的数据清洗操作。

数据转换:Power Query还可以用于数据转换任务,例如将数据从一种格式转换为另一种格式。这对于需要将尾数变成特定格式的情况非常有用。

九、使用DAX函数(在Power BI中)

如果你使用的是Power BI,可以使用DAX函数来实现将尾数变成你想要的数字。DAX函数是Power BI中的一种数据分析表达式语言,非常适合用于复杂的数据计算任务。

1. DAX函数的基本用法

你可以使用DAX函数将数字格式化为特定的样式。例如,如果你想将数字123.456四舍五入到整数,可以使用公式 ROUND(123.456, 0)

2. 应用场景

实时数据分析:DAX函数非常适合用于实时数据分析任务,例如根据数据的变化动态调整数字的格式。通过使用DAX函数,你可以实现复杂的数据计算和分析。

数据展示:DAX函数还可以用于数据展示任务,例如将数据格式化为特定的样式,提高数据的可读性和易理解性。

十、使用插件和第三方工具

除了Excel自带的功能外,还有许多插件和第三方工具可以帮助你将尾数变成你想要的数字。这些工具通常提供更高级的功能和更友好的用户界面。

1. 插件和工具的基本用法

你可以安装一些Excel插件或使用第三方工具来实现将尾数变成你想要的数字。例如,Kutools for Excel是一个非常流行的Excel插件,提供了许多高级功能,包括数据格式化、数据清洗等。

2. 应用场景

高级数据处理:插件和第三方工具通常提供更高级的数据处理功能,可以帮助你实现复杂的数据操作。例如,Kutools for Excel提供了许多高级的数据格式化选项,可以轻松将尾数变成你想要的数字。

用户友好性:相比于手动编写公式或代码,使用插件和第三方工具通常更为简单和直观。通过使用这些工具,你可以更快速地完成数据处理任务。

总结

在Excel中,将尾数变成你想要的数字的方法多种多样,包括使用ROUND函数、TEXT函数、VBA代码、条件格式化、自定义格式、替换功能、数组公式、Power Query、DAX函数以及插件和第三方工具。通过根据具体需求选择合适的方法,你可以轻松实现数据的精确控制和展示。无论是简单的四舍五入操作,还是复杂的数据清洗和转换任务,Excel都能提供强大的支持,帮助你提高工作效率和数据处理能力。

相关问答FAQs:

1. 问题:在Excel中,如何将尾数转换成所需的数字格式?

答:要将尾数转换成所需的数字格式,请按照以下步骤操作:

  • 选中要转换的单元格或单元格范围。
  • 在Excel的菜单栏上选择“格式”选项卡。
  • 在格式选项卡中,选择“数字”类别。
  • 在数字类别中,选择所需的数字格式,例如“百分比”、“货币”或“科学计数法”等。
  • 确认选择,单元格的尾数将会根据所选的数字格式进行转换。

2. 问题:如何将Excel中的尾数四舍五入到所需的数字?

答:如果您想将Excel中的尾数四舍五入到所需的数字,请按照以下步骤进行操作:

  • 选中要四舍五入的单元格或单元格范围。
  • 在Excel的菜单栏上选择“函数”选项卡。
  • 在函数选项卡中,选择“数学和三角函数”类别。
  • 在数学和三角函数类别中,选择“ROUND”函数。
  • 在ROUND函数中,输入要四舍五入的单元格引用或数值,并指定所需的小数位数。
  • 确认选择,Excel会自动将尾数四舍五入到所需的数字。

3. 问题:如何使用Excel的公式将尾数转换成想要的数字?

答:若要使用Excel的公式将尾数转换成想要的数字,请按照以下步骤进行操作:

  • 在要转换的单元格中输入以下公式:=INT(要转换的尾数) + 所需的数字
  • 例如,如果要将尾数转换为整数并加上10,可以输入=INT(A1) + 10,其中A1是要转换的单元格引用。
  • 按下Enter键,Excel会根据公式将尾数转换成您所需的数字。
  • 如果需要将结果应用于其他单元格,请将公式拖动或复制到其他单元格中。

希望以上解答对您有所帮助!如果您还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4296119

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部